Football: The case for keeping head coach Charlie Partridge

The football team’s slow start to the season should not put Partridge’s job in risk.

Head coach Charlie Partridge puts up owl fingers to fans after FAU's 20-14 overtime loss at the University of Florida last season. Mohammed F. Emran | Staff Photographer

Editor’s note: FAU Athletics has not said that Charlie Partridge’s job is in jeopardy.

Florida Atlantic football is off to a 1-6 start, causing a number of fans to call for the firing of head coach Charlie Partridge.

Partridge is in his third season as head coach and currently holds a career record of 7-24.
